South Korean soldiers in Yeonpyeong

South Korean soldiers in Yeonpyeong

YEONPYEONG ISLAND, South Korea - South Korean soldiers receive soup from the Red Cross on Yeonpyeong Island on Nov. 27, 2010. Food supply on the South Korean island, which was shelled by North Koreans on Nov. 23, is sometimes insufficient as ships have been unable to sail due to rough sea conditions.

Bluefin tuna quota to be cut

Bluefin tuna quota to be cut

PARIS, France - Photo shows tuna auctioned at Tokyo's Tsukiji Fish Market on Nov. 26, 2010. The International Commission for the Conservation of Atlantic Tunas decided Nov. 27, 2010, to slightly reduce the bluefin tuna fishing quota for 2011 by 4.4 percent from a year earlier to 12,900 tons.

New Char's Zaku plastic model

New Char's Zaku plastic model

TOKYO, Japan - Photo shows Bandai Co.'s new plastic model of Char Aznable's special ''Zaku'' combat robot from the Japanese anime ''Mobile Suit Gundam'' which will go on sale in Japan on Nov. 27, 2010, for 2,625 yen. The 12.2-centimeter-tall figure consists of parts which come in eight colors, more than any similar past models, and has many movable joints.
